About GERRY WAKKER

GERRY WAKKER is a scholar working on Anthropology, Language and Linguistics and Philosophy, having authored 4 papers that have together received 38 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Classical Antiquity Studies (2 papers), Classical Philosophy and Thought (2 papers) and Linguistics and language evolution (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Language and Linguistics (19 citations), Anthropology (14 citations) and Philosophy (11 citations). GERRY WAKKER has collaborated with scholars based in France. Frequent co-authors include Helma Dik and Philip J. van der Eijk. Their work appears in journals such as University of Groningen research database (University of Groningen / Centre for Information Technology) and Data Archiving and Networked Services (DANS).
